Southern-Style Black-Eyed Peas
Discover a twist on traditional Southern-style black-eyed peas with smoky bacon and a touch of spice for a comforting, flavorful dish.
Prep time: 15 minutesCook time: 1 hour 30 minutesServes: 6
Ingredients
1 lb dried black-eyed peas
6 cups water
4 slices smoked bacon, chopped
1 medium onion, diced
2 garlic cloves, minced
1 tsp smoked paprika
1/2 tsp cayenne pepper
1 tsp salt
1/2 tsp black pepper
1 bay leaf
2 tbsp apple cider vinegar
1 tbsp olive oil
2 green onions, chopped for garnish
Instructions
1. Rinse and sort the black-eyed peas.
2. In a large pot, add the peas and 6 cups of water. Bring to a boil, then reduce to a simmer.
3. In a skillet over medium heat, cook the bacon until crisp. Remove and set aside, leaving the grease in the skillet.
4. Add the onion and garlic to the skillet and sauté until translucent.
5. Add the bacon, onion, and garlic to the pot with the peas.
6. Stir in the smoked paprika, cayenne, salt, black pepper, and bay leaf, and let it simmer for about 1 hour or until peas are tender.
7. Stir in the apple cider vinegar and olive oil.
8. Remove the bay leaf before serving.
9. Garnish with green onions.
Storage
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
Reheating
Reheat on the stove over medium heat, adding a splash of water if necessary, until warmed through.
